#2b1332 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2b1332 is composed of 16.9% red, 7.5% green and 19.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 14% cyan, 62% magenta, 0% yellow and 80.4% black. It has a hue angle of 286.5 degrees, a saturation of 44.9% and a lightness of 13.5%. #2b1332 color hex could be obtained by blending #562664 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330033.

● #2b1332 color description : Very dark (mostly black) magenta.
#2b1332 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2b1332 has RGB values of R:43, G:19, B:50 and CMYK values of C:0.14, M:0.62, Y:0, K:0.8. Its decimal value is 2822962.

Shades and Tints of #2b1332
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060307 is the darkest color, while #fbf8f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#2b1332
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#242025 is the less saturated color, while #350045 is the most saturated one.
